您的位置:首页 >如何解决Windows系统启动提示“No Bootable Device” 修复磁盘引导方法
发布于2026-04-25 阅读(0)
扫一扫,手机访问
开机时屏幕上跳出“No Bootable Device”这行字,确实让人心头一紧。这行提示说白了就是:电脑在启动的“寻路”阶段,没能从任何存储设备里找到有效的引导程序。问题根源通常指向几个方向:硬盘压根没被识别、启动顺序排错了队、关键的引导文件损坏了,或者是磁盘分区配置出了岔子。别慌,下面这几种修复方法,你可以像排查故障清单一样,逐一尝试。

第一步,咱们先排除最简单的干扰项。有时候,问题根本不是出在电脑内置硬盘上,而是插在电脑上的U盘、移动硬盘甚至是一张SD卡“惹的祸”。如果BIOS或UEFI固件被设置成优先从这些外部设备启动,而它们偏偏又不包含有效的引导信息,电脑就会直接报出这个错误。
具体操作很简单:
1. 完全关闭电脑,然后拔掉所有USB接口的设备。这包括U盘、给手机充电的数据线、扩展坞,甚至无线键盘鼠标的接收器也别放过。
2. 接着,断开所有非必要的存储类外设,比如SD卡读卡器、外接的固态或机械硬盘,如果有光驱也一并断开。
3. 做完这些,再按下电源键开机,看看那个恼人的提示是否还会出现。
如果排除了外部干扰,问题依旧,那咱们就得往“里”看了。这一步的目的是确认硬盘是否在最基础的硬件层面被主板正确“看见”。数据线松了、供电没接好、M.2固态硬盘没插紧,都可能导致硬盘在BIOS里“隐身”。
操作时请务必小心:
1. 首先,关机并拔掉电源适配器(笔记本)或主机的电源线(台式机),确保完全断电。
2. 打开台式机的机箱侧板,或者根据笔记本型号的拆机指南,卸下底盖。
3. 重点检查连接线:对于SATA硬盘,看看数据线两端是否牢牢插在主板和硬盘的接口上;如果是M.2 NVMe固态硬盘,确认其金手指已经完全插入插槽,并且用螺丝固定稳妥了。
4. 顺便检查一下供电:台式机的SATA电源线、主板上给M.2接口的供电线路是否正常。有条件的话,可以尝试换一个SATA接口或者换条数据线试试,交叉验证一下。
5. 重新装好盖板,接通电源开机。在启动瞬间,快速按下进入BIOS/UEFI的按键(戴尔通常是F2,联想是F1,华硕/技嘉等常用Del或F2)。
6. 进入后,找到“Main”或“Storage Information”这类选项卡。关键来了:看看你的硬盘型号和容量有没有显示在列表里。如果显示的是Not Detected(未检测到)或者干脆是空白,那基本可以断定是硬件连接或硬盘本身出了故障。
硬盘在BIOS里能被识别,只是过了第一关。如果启动顺序没设对,或者相关的磁盘控制器被无意中禁用了,系统照样会跳过你的硬盘,然后报错。
进入BIOS/UEFI后,跟着下面几步走:
1. 切换到“Boot”或“Startup”选项卡。
2. 先看“Boot Mode”这一项。这里有个重要匹配原则:如果你的操作系统当初是以UEFI模式安装的,这里必须选择UEFI Only;如果是传统的MBR模式安装的,则需要启用Legacy或CSM兼容模式。
3. 接着,在启动设备列表里,找到Windows Boot Manager(UEFI模式下的选项)或者你的具体硬盘名称(比如“Samsung SSD 970 EVO”),确保它被排在“Boot Option #1”的位置。
4. 要是压根在启动列表里找不到硬盘条目,别急。再切换到“Advanced”或“Configuration”这类高级选项卡,找找“SATA Controller”、“NVMe Configuration”或“Storage Configuration”这些设置项,确保它们的状态是Enabled(已启用)。
5. 最后,按F10保存设置并退出,让电脑自动重启。
走到这一步,说明硬盘硬件和BIOS设置大概率都没问题,问题很可能出在软件层面——引导文件损坏了。对于UEFI启动、GPT磁盘分区的系统,通常是EFI系统分区里的文件出了岔子,比如BCD配置损坏或者bootmgr.efi文件丢失。这时候,我们需要借助Windows安装U盘来“重建”引导环境。
具体流程如下:
1. 准备一个Windows安装U盘,关键是要和原系统的版本匹配(比如原来是Windows 11 22H2,就别用21H2的镜像)。
2. 插入U盘后重启电脑,在开机瞬间按F12、F9等快捷键(因品牌而异)调出临时启动菜单,选择从U盘启动。
3. 进入Windows安装界面后,别点“现在安装”,而是点击左下角的“修复计算机”。然后依次选择“疑难解答” -> “高级选项” -> “命令提示符”。
4. 在打开的命令提示符窗口里,依次输入下面两条命令,每输入一行就按一次回车:
diskpart
list volume
exit
5. 这会列出所有磁盘卷。你需要从中找到被标记为“System”的那个卷(通常是100–500MB大小的FAT32分区),记下它的盘符(比如S:)。同时,确认Windows系统所在的盘符(通常是C:)。
6. 最后,依次执行以下修复命令(这里假设系统盘是C:,EFI系统分区是S:):
bootrec /fixmbr
bootrec /fixboot
bcdboot C:\Windows /s S: /f UEFI
如果连引导分区本身都出了问题,比如被误删、没有激活(针对MBR磁盘)或者分区类型标志错误(针对GPT磁盘),那上面的命令修复可能也无力回天。这时候,一个功能强大的Windows PE启动盘就能派上大用场了。
1. 你需要提前准备一个制作好的Windows PE启动U盘,里面最好包含像DiskGenius(简称DG)这样的磁盘分区工具。
2. 从PE U盘启动电脑,运行DiskGenius。在主界面,你可以清晰地看到磁盘的分区结构。
3. 找到那个容量大约100–500MB、文件系统为FAT32的分区。对于MBR磁盘,右键点击它,选择“设置分区为活动分区”;对于GPT磁盘,则需要确认它的分区类型标志是“EFI System”。
4. 如果发现这个关键的分区根本不存在或者已经损坏,问题就比较严重了。你可以在DiskGenius中右键点击整个磁盘,选择“建立新分区表”,然后重新创建一个EFI系统分区并格式化为FAT32。
5. 完成分区操作后,重启电脑,再次进入Windows安装环境,执行上面第四步提到的`bcdboot`命令,重新构建引导配置,问题通常就能得到解决。
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
正版软件
正版软件
正版软件
正版软件
正版软件
1
2
3
4
5
6
7
8
9